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P6_Very_StrongBS2

The NM_206933.4(USH2A):​c.15427C>T​(p.Arg5143Cys) variant causes a missense change. The variant allele was found at a frequency of 0.000297 in 1,614,120 control chromosomes in the GnomAD database, including 7 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R5143H) has been classified as Benign.

USH2A (HGNC:12601): (usherin) This gene encodes a protein that contains laminin EGF motifs, a pentaxin domain, and many fibronectin type III motifs. The protein is found in the basement membrane, and may be important in development and homeostasis of the inner ear and retina. Mutations within this gene have been associated with Usher syndrome type IIa and retinitis pigmentosa. Multiple transcript variants encoding different isoforms have been found for this gene. Arg5143Cys in exon 71 of USH2A: This variant is not expected to have clinical s ignificance because it has been identified in 1.0% (89/8652) of East Asian chrom osomes by the Exome Aggregation Consortium (ExAC, http://exac.broadinstitute.org ; dbSNP rs145771342). -
